“The Unthinkable Transfer” The Norwegian Directorate for Children, Youth and Family Affairs (Bufdir) oversees the recruitment of foster homes in Norway. Their research indicates that women are more inclined to become foster parents than men. Our mission was to design a campaign that emotionally resonates with men, encouraging their active involvement in this crucial role.
Football evokes strong emotions among Norwegians in general, and Norwegian men in particular. And Norwegians just love English football. More Norwegians belong to supporter clubs for English football teams than to all Norwegian elite league teams combined. In fact, the number of Norwegian supporters of English football surpasses the total membership of all Norwegian political parties. Liverpool has the largest fan base among football clubs in Norway. At the same time, due to the popularity of striker Erling Braut Haaland, there has been a surge in Norwegian kids training in Manchester City jerseys.
This inspired a story about a die-hard football fan who adheres to the unwavering principle of never switching football clubs. After securing the rights to the world’s most famous football anthem, the sound of Anfield singing “You'll Never Walk Alone” was recreated for the film. The film premiered in Norway on Boxing Day and will follow the Premier League broadcasts of the Norwegian rights holder Viaplay.
